Our Gate Installation Services in Roseland

Swing Gate Installation

Swing gates remain the most common type we install in Roseland, especially on the narrower driveways of the 1950s–1970s tract homes near Burbank Avenue and Hearn Avenue. A single swing gate in Roseland typically costs $2,800–$4,200 installed; a double swing runs $3,800–$5,500. The critical detail here is swing clearance — Santa Rosa’s current municipal code requires more setback than the old county rules, and many legacy gates open directly into the driveway or sidewalk. We measure your actual arc, check the grade, and specify hardware that meets code without eating your parking space.

Sliding Gate Installation

Sliding gates are the solution when your Roseland driveway slopes steeply toward the street or when a swing gate would block the sidewalk. We’ve installed sliding systems on properties along Sebastopol Road where the grade makes swing impossible. Budget $4,500–$6,500 for a standard residential sliding gate with motor, track, and access control. The track foundation is the make-or-break detail in Roseland — we pour concrete footings below the clay soil’s active zone so seasonal ground movement doesn’t throw your gate off its rollers in two years.

Double Gate Installation

Double gates — two independent swing leaves meeting in the middle — work well on wider Roseland driveways, particularly on corner lots and duplex properties. They’re also easier to retrofit when a single wide gate was installed under old county rules and now needs to meet Santa Rosa’s current setback requirements. Splitting one gate into two can gain you the clearance you need without rebuilding the entire opening. Typical installed cost: $3,800–$5,500.

Driveway & Pedestrian Gate Installation

Many Roseland homes have a driveway gate plus a separate pedestrian gate, often both wrought-iron from the same 1980s or 1990s installation. When we replace one, we inspect the other — the same wet-dry cycle that rotted your driveway gate’s wood post base has likely corroded the pedestrian gate’s lower hinge. Coordinating both replacements saves on mobilization and ensures matching access-control integration. Pedestrian gates alone run $1,800–$3,200.

Common Gate Installation Problems We See in Roseland Homes

  • Post-lean from clay soil movement. Roseland’s clay-heavy soils expand in winter rains and contract in summer drought, gradually tilting gate posts out of plumb. We see this every March after the heavy rains — gates that worked fine in October now drag or won’t latch. Post resetting with deeper footings below the active zone solves it for the long term.
  • Hinge corrosion and deep rust on 1980s–1990s wrought iron. The neighborhood’s ornamental iron gates — a common aesthetic in Roseland’s predominantly Latino community — were often painted once and forgotten. Triple-digit summer heat bakes the paint, winter rain penetrates, and by year 30 the hinge pins are frozen solid or the leaves have rusted through at the post connection. Sometimes we can cut and weld new hinge boxes; sometimes the post itself is too compromised.
  • Obsolete openers with no replacement parts. That original LiftMaster from 1994 or Mighty Mule from 1987? The boards are discontinued, the gear kits are NLA, and the safety standards have changed. We retrofit modern operators onto existing gate structures, which costs less than full replacement and gets you current safety features.
  • Escrow flags on unpermitted gates. Since Roseland’s 2019 annexation into Santa Rosa, title companies and escrow inspectors are increasingly checking gate permits. A gate installed in 1985 under loose county standards now needs to meet city code for setbacks, swing clearance, and safety hardware. We’ve done dozens of these “repair” jobs that are really compliance retrofits — usually discovered when the seller calls panicking two weeks before close.

Pricing for Gate Installation in Roseland, CA

Gate Type Typical Installed Range Notes
Single swing gate (steel/aluminum) $2,800 – $4,200 Includes standard LiftMaster or Elite operator
Double swing gate $3,800 – $5,500 Two operators or articulated arm setup
Sliding gate $4,500 – $6,500 Track, foundation, motor, access control
Pedestrian gate only $1,800 – $3,200 Manual or automated; wrought-iron retrofit common
Compliance retrofit (escrow flag) $1,200 – $3,800 Varies by code gap; hinge relocation, hardware upgrade, permit assistance
Post reset / foundation repair $800 – $2,200 Clay soil depth; often paired with gate replacement

What moves you within these ranges: material choice (aluminum vs. steel vs. wrought iron), automation level, access-control features, and whether we’re working from a clean slate or retrofitting around existing masonry. Compliance-driven jobs — the escrow flags, the post-annexation retrofits — often land in predictable bands because we’ve done enough of them to know where the time goes.
